Bo
Boston Spot-Lite, Inc.
304 Newbury St, Boston, MA 02115, United States
Information
  • Address:304 Newbury St, Boston, MA 02115, United States
  • Site:http://www.bostonspotlite.com/
  • Phone:+1 617-247-0001
Categories
  • Marketing consultant
Service options
  • Online appointments:Yes
Similar organizations